Finance teams deal with document chaos every day. Faded receipts from thermal printers, skewed invoice scans, handwritten notes on purchase orders, and blurry photos of bank statements. Traditional OCR tools often fail on these messy documents, forcing teams back to manual data entry.
Modern AI-powered OCR tools are changing this. By combining optical character recognition with machine learning and intelligent pre-processing, these tools can extract accurate data from documents that would have been impossible to process automatically just a few years ago.
Basic OCR technology works well on clean, high-contrast documents with standard layouts. But real-world business documents rarely meet these ideal conditions.
Blurry images happen when documents are photographed with shaky hands, scanners are set to low resolution, original documents have faded over time, or photos are taken in poor lighting. Traditional OCR produces garbage output from blurry images. AI-powered tools use image pre-processing to enhance contrast, sharpen edges, and improve readability before attempting text recognition.
When documents are scanned at an angle or photographed on an uneven surface, text lines are no longer horizontal, column alignment is lost, and table structures become unrecognizable. Modern OCR tools detect document boundaries and apply perspective correction to straighten the image before processing.
Handwriting recognition remains one of the hardest problems in document processing. Challenges include inconsistent letter shapes between writers, connected or overlapping characters, and mixed printed and handwritten text. AI models trained on handwriting can recognize many common patterns, but accuracy varies significantly based on handwriting quality.
Business documents come in many formats: structured invoices, semi-structured receipts, unstructured letters, and complex tables. A single OCR tool must handle all these formats intelligently.

Use 300 DPI or higher, keep documents straight on the scanner bed, clean the glass, and use black and white mode for text documents.
Use adequate lighting, keep the camera steady, fill the frame with the document, and use the guided capture feature. FormX's mobile SDK includes real-time guidance to help users capture better images.
Group similar documents, set up validation rules, monitor accuracy over time, and provide feedback on errors to help the AI learn.
